Nicki Minaj's ex-fiancé Safaree Samuels says that he feels free following his break up with his girlfriend of 12-years.

The rapper said that he doesn't mind seeing his ex- girlfriend prance around with MMG rapper Meek Mill or even see flirtatious social media interactions between his ex and label mate Drake.

"I didn't even know he did that." He then states, "I look at that stuff as entertainment. I don't take none of that to heart." He added about her recent engagement with Meek, "It is what it is." He explained, "If that's who she chooses to be with it don't have nothing to do with me. If I was a bitter jealous person and I was miserable in my life right now, it'll be different, but mentally, I haven't been this happy in -God knows how long." He added, "I just feel free."

The rapper said that he hasn't spoken to The Pinkprint star since New Year's and doesn't plan on talking to her nor does not see a future with her.

"She's moved on, I've moved on. When people break up, it's for a reason. It's not a break."
